<bean id="dataSource" class="org.logicalcobwebs.proxool.ProxoolDataSource">
<property name="driver" value="${jdbc.driverClassName}" />
<property name="driverUrl" value="${jdbc.url}" />
<property name="user" value="${jdbc.username}" />
<property name="password" value="${jdbc.password}" />
<property name="alias" value="drpdb" />
<property name="maximumConnectionCount" value="20" />
<property name="minimumConnectionCount" value="1" />
<property name="delegateProperties" value="user=${jdbc.username},password=${jdbc.password}" />
<property name="houseKeepingSleepTime" value="50000" />
<property name="prototypeCount" value="2" />
<property name="maximumConnectionLifetime" value="18000000" />
<property name="maximumActiveTime" value="60000" />
<property name="simultaneousBuildThrottle" value="5" />
<property name="recentlyStartedThreshold" value="40000" />
<property name="overloadWithoutRefusalLifetime" value="50000" />
<property name="houseKeepingTestSql" value="select CURRENT_DATE" />
<property name="verbose" value="true" />
<property name="trace" value="true" />
<property name="statistics" value="10s,1m,1d" />
<property name="statisticsLogLevel" value="ERROR" />
</bean>
分享到:
相关推荐
2. 配置Hibernate:在Hibernate的主配置文件(通常是hibernate.cfg.xml)中,需要定义数据源,指定使用Proxool连接池。例如: ```xml <hibernate-configuration> ... <property name="hibernate.connection....
文件`Spring3+Hibernate+Proxool_lj配置试验成功.txt`表明Spring3和Hibernate已经成功地集成了Proxool,这可能涉及到了Spring的`DataSource`配置,通过`<bean>`标签定义一个数据源,然后在Hibernate配置中引用它。...
在Spring框架中,我们可以将Proxool配置为Hibernate的数据源,以实现数据库连接的自动获取和释放。 在描述中提到的“连接池配置文件”,通常是指像`proxoolconf.xml`这样的文件,其中包含了Proxool连接池的配置参数...
-- Proxool配置 --> ``` 3. **配置Hibernate**: 在Hibernate的配置文件(如`hibernate.cfg.xml`)中,将数据源设置为刚刚创建的Proxool数据源bean。比如: ```xml <hibernate-configuration> ... .....
Hibernate的三种连接池设置C3P0、Proxool和DBCP. 详细说明及配置方法 Hibernate支持第三方的连接池,官方推荐的连接池是C3P0,Proxool,以及DBCP.
Hibernate通过配置文件(如hibernate.cfg.xml)可以设置Proxool的相关参数,如最大连接数、最小空闲连接数、超时时间等。 Nebula测试项目中的渐变插件测试线束可能包括测试用例、测试脚本以及相关的测试报告,用于...
在这里,我们通过`dataSource`属性引用了上面配置的数据源,这样Hibernate就能使用Proxool连接池进行数据库操作。 5. 在`hibernateProperties`中,我们设置了`hibernate.dialect`为`MySQLDialect`,表示使用的是...
这个问题通常是由于Hibernate4与Proxool数据源集成时的配置不当或版本不兼容所引起的。 Proxool是Apache的一个开源项目,提供了一个轻量级的连接池,用于管理数据库连接,提高应用性能。在Hibernate4中,Proxool...
2. **配置Proxool**:在Hibernate配置文件中,需要添加Proxool的特定属性,如最大活动连接数、最大空闲时间、初始连接数等。 3. **创建实体类**:根据数据库表结构,创建对应的Java实体类,用注解或XML映射文件描述...
这里,`hibernate.connection.datasource`指定了使用Proxool作为数据源,`pool_name`是连接池的唯一标识,`driver_aliases`是数据库驱动的别名,`max_size`定义了连接池的最大容量,`maxStatements`表示最大预编译...
在构建企业级Java应用...最后,我们需要在Hibernate的配置中引用Spring配置的数据源,这样Hibernate就可以通过Spring获取到数据库连接。这通常通过在Hibernate的`hibernate.cfg.xml`文件中添加以下内容完成: ```xml ...
在Java Web开发中,XML常用于配置文件,如Hibernate的配置文件,它定义了实体映射、数据源和其他设置。解析XML文件是理解这些配置并据此设置应用程序的关键步骤。 **6. Log4j:** Log4j是Java日志记录工具,提供...
在Spring配置中,可以通过定义Proxool的数据源,实现对数据库连接的池化管理,提升系统并发性能。 4. **jstl**:JavaServer Pages Standard Tag Library(JSTL)是一组标准标签库,用于简化JSP页面的编写。在这个...
这里配置了数据源、连接池名称、驱动类、数据库URL、用户名和密码。 3. **配置Proxool的属性**:除了基本的数据库连接信息,还可以设置其他Proxool的参数,如最大活动连接数、最小空闲连接数等。例如: ```xml ...